Anyone ever been on a DCL cruise during Halloween, I have been on a cruise around Halloween but never ok Halloween...what if anything special does DCL do?
 
I'm interested as well. We are booked on the magic over Halloween this year!
 
When we went on a cruise around Halloween they had trick or treat stations set up one night on the cruise... Did the fantasy at least do that?

The Dream did not this year. We had to switch the CC day/sea day because of Sandy, though. So whereas Halloween should have fallen on a sea day, it was the CC day instead. That may have put a damper on their plans. There were CMs wandering around the Halloween party (up on the pool deck) dumping handfuls of candy into kids' bags, but no trick-or-treating. In fact, just yesterday my 8yo was lamenting the fact that her candy bag wasn't "filled to overflowing" (her words!) as usual when we are home. It's a long story involving it being a surprise cruise, but we will never do another Halloween cruise again. It just wasn't special enough for my kids. As in, they would rather have had the one big Halloween day at home than 4 on the ship. I think that's totally crazy, but Halloween is important to an 8yo and a 5yo I guess. I agree, we would never do a Halloween cruise again either, we had a great cruise but at that age my daughter is 7, trick or treating is more important;) and no trick or treat stations on the Fantasy. Our Halloween day was the 30th and we were in Costa Maya for the day. Our cruise was also affected by Sandy we lost a port, Grand Cayman, and gained a sea day.
